Colin at 11 months

Hard to believe, but Colin's been around almost a year! We had great fun watching him develop this month. He's losing many of his baby qualities and turning into a toddler right in front of our eyes!

The big news is that Colin can stand on his own. He doesn't really like to and if it happens, it's usually by accident and he corrects the situation as soon as possible. Typically, a pesky toy has distracted in him and in his haste to explore if more fully, he lets go of whatever support he's been clutching. Also, Colin's beginning to take a few more risks in transitioning from one support to another while creeping, letting go for just a second to the couch so he can get to the ottoman, for example. He is just beginning to tolerate being walked... Mom or Dad holding his hands up while he takes a few steps. He is happier to use some sort of outside toy - car, etc to push along, like here:



Colin has become a lot more playful in the last month. His favorite by far is peekaboo. He both likes to hide and seek, and often initiates the game with a blanket, piece of clothing, or curtain. He has shown a lot more interest in his books this past month. Not surprisingly, his favorite is called Baby Farm Animals Peekaboo! He also enjoys "Little Spider" and "The Very Hungry Frog," both of which have a place for the reader to put their finger in to make the spider move or the frog's eyes wiggle. He continues to love his rings and spindle, but his new favorite toy is the shape sorter. He's actually quite talented - he can get a cylinder as well square, triangle, and hexagonal prisms through a matching slot! His shape sorter is a hippopotamus that spits out the shapes when you pump a handle. Colin loves to bang on that handle but has trouble getting them out of the hippo's belly.

On the communication front, Colin babbles a ton. His teacher told me he says "oh no" but I have yet to hear it. Today I heard "go" over and over. He has learned the baby sign for "more" which he uses at the table, especially when he wants more puffs. It's clear he understands a lot more words, so we've been working a lot on asking him to find us certain items to see if he knows a word, like "car," 'ball," "cup," etc. He seems to understand a lot of words at the dinner table, like "cheese," "puffs," "applesauce," and "water."
